By Mayo Clinic Staff Cholesterol numbers show how much cholesterol is circulating in your blood. Your HDL (good) cholesterol is the one number you want to be high (above 60). Your LDL (bad) cholesterol should be below 100. Your total should be below 200. Learn more about normal, high and low cholesterol levels, how to measure them and how to manage them. Cholesterol circulates in the blood. As the amount of cholesterol in your blood increases, so does the risk to your health. High cholesterol contributes to a higher risk of cardiovascular diseases, such as heart disease and stroke. That's why it's important to have your cholesterol tested, so you can know your levels.
